No. 3 -- Duke Dawson

Facts: Draft Year: 2018
Round Selected: 2
Overall Pick: 56
Current Team: Pittsburgh Steelers. Dawson was signed to the Steelers’ practice squad in October 2022 and signed a futures/reserves contract with the Steelers in January 2023.
2022 Production: None

Alternative Picks – On the defensive side, the Pats could have selected future Pro Bowl linebacker Fred Warner, or on offense, they could have gone with tight end Mark Andrews and spared themselves the double misery of selecting TE washouts Dalton Keene and Devin Asiasi in the 2020 draft. If the Pats desperately wanted a cornerback, they could have chosen Carlton Davis.

Comment: Davis, who has had a steady career with Tampa Bay Buccaneers, would seem to have been a more logical choice than Dawson. In its 2022 review of CBs, Pro Football Focus noted of Davis that “No cornerback has forced more incompletions over the past three years of regular-season action than him (45).” Before the 2018 draft, Drafttek.com ranked Davis as its 6th-best CB and Dawson as its 12th-best CB.
